How much do amazon fashion designer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for amazon fashion designer in the United States is $69,494.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,000.00 and $89,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for an Amazon Fashion Designer?

As an Amazon Fashion Designer, your daily tasks often include sketching and developing new product concepts, collaborating with merchandising and sourcing teams, and reviewing samples to ensure quality and fit meet brand standards. You’ll also analyze market trends and customer data to inform design decisions and may participate in virtual meetings with overseas manufacturers. The fast-paced nature of Amazon means you’ll manage multiple projects simultaneously and need to adapt quickly to changing consumer preferences. This dynamic environment offers opportunities for creative input, teamwork, and seeing your designs reach a global audience.

What does an Amazon Fashion Designer do?

An Amazon Fashion Designer creates clothing, footwear, and accessories for Amazon's private-label fashion brands. They conduct market research, analyze trends, and develop designs that align with customer preferences. The role involves collaborating with product managers, suppliers, and manufacturers to ensure quality and cost-effectiveness. Designers also use software like Adobe Illustrator and Photoshop to create sketches and technical specifications. The goal is to deliver stylish, high-quality, and affordable fashion for Amazon customers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Amazon Fashion Designer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Amazon Fashion Designer, you need a strong background in fashion design, trend research, garment construction, and ideally a degree in fashion or a related field. Familiarity with design software such as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, and CAD systems is highly valued, along with knowledge of e-commerce platforms and product lifecycle management tools. Creative problem-solving, adaptability, and strong teamwork and communication skills are essential for collaborating across multi-disciplinary teams. These skills are critical for delivering innovative, market-relevant designs that align with Amazon’s fast-paced, customer-centric business environment.

Amazon.com, Inc., commonly known as Amazon, is an American multinational technology company. It was founded by Jeff Bezos in 1994 and initially started as an online marketplace for books. Since then, Amazon has expanded its operations and become one of the largest e-commerce companies in the world. Amazon's primary business is its online retail platform, where customers can purchase a vast array of products, including electronics, clothing, books, home goods, and much more. The company offers a convenient and user-friendly shopping experience, with features such as fast shipping, customer reviews, and personalized recommendations. In addition to its e-commerce platform, Amazon has diversified its business into various other areas. One of its notable ventures is Amazon Web Services (AWS), a comprehensive cloud computing platform that provides services such as storage, compute power, and database management to individuals and businesses. AWS has become a leader in the cloud computing industry, powering many websites and applications worldwide. Amazon has also developed its own consumer electronics, including the popular Amazon Kindle e-reader, Fire tablets, Fire TV streaming devices, and the Alexa-powered Echo smart speakers. The Alexa voice assistant, integrated into these devices, allows users to interact with their devices using voice commands, perform tasks, and access information. Furthermore, Amazon has expanded into media and entertainment. It operates Prime Video, a streaming service that offers a wide range of movies, TV shows, and original content. Amazon Music provides a platform for streaming and purchasing digital music, while Audible offers audiobooks and other audio content. The company's commitment to customer satisfaction and convenience is demonstrated by its membership program, Amazon Prime. Prime members receive various benefits, including free two-day shipping, access to streaming services, exclusive deals, and more.
